Appassionante are made up of Giorgia, Mara and Stefania, three singers that with their unique differences and ability to fuse colored tessituras between their voices, capture all of the passion and energy of Italian lyrical music by blending elegance and femininity, and tradition with modernity. All started in Rome in 2002, from the vision of the Italian producer Mauro Borzellino and his label Overlook Italia. The idea was to create a crossover genre based on classic-pop and performed by three Mediterranean women, three very skilled lyrical singers. This unusual mix between lyrical music and pop music immediately generated interest and curiosity: the three girls soon started to perform in many festival and shows; since then they started touring Italy and the world showing their own uniqueness. Their unquestionable scenic and esthetic presence is emphasized and enriched thanks to the co-operation with the Italian fashion stylist Marella Ferrera who has shaped and modelled their esthetic essence by evoking the '500, the era when corset as a costume and opera as a musical genre were born.
Appassionante plays classical crossover music, blending traditional Italian opera vocals with contemporary pop arrangements and cinematic production.

The vocal trio was originally formed in Rome, Italy, in 2002.
The group consists of three sopranos: Giorgia, Mara, and Stefania.
